One year after a historic designation blocked attempts, the 26-34 Church Lane vacant lot is set for redevelopment
At a public meeting, the Philadelphia Historical Commission opposed the plans for 26-34 Church Lane, citing concerns over the development's size and impact on the Germantown Urban Village Historic District. However, fueled by a court win, the developers intend to move forward with the controversial original design. Neighbors remain opposed.
